Question

The actual height of a book is 914 inches. Beverly estimates the height of the book and finds her percent error to be less than 4%.

What range of values represents Beverly's estimated height?

To find the range of values that represents Beverly's estimated height, we start by calculating the acceptable error range based on the actual height of the book, which is 914 inches.

  1. Determine the maximum percent error: 4% of the actual height. \[ \text{Percent error} = \frac{\text{Estimated height} - \text{Actual height}}{\text{Actual height}} \times 100% \] We can express this in terms of actual height: \[ \text{Estimated height} = \text{Actual height} \pm (\text{Actual height} \times \text{Percent error}) \]

  2. Calculate 4% of the actual height: \[ 0.04 \times 914 = 36.56 \text{ inches} \]

  3. Calculate the range for estimated height: To find the lower and upper bounds:

    • Lower bound: \( 914 - 36.56 = 877.44 \text{ inches} \)
    • Upper bound: \( 914 + 36.56 = 950.56 \text{ inches} \)

Thus, Beverly's estimated height is between approximately \( 877.44 \) inches and \( 950.56 \) inches.

Final answer:

Beverly's estimated height is between 877.44 inches and 950.56 inches.
